Best time to go to Hanamaki

The best time to visit Hanamaki is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with moderate r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January24.8°F (-4.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
February25.9°F (-3.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March34.5°F (1.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
April44.8°F (7.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
May55.8°F (13.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
June63.0°F (17.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
July70.3°F (21.3°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
August71.6°F (22.0°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
September63.9°F (17.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
October52.2°F (11.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
November41.5°F (5.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
December30.0°F (-1.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low

The nearest major airports for your trip to Hanamaki

Traveling to Hanamaki, Iwate Prefecture, Japan, offers two major airport options. Hanamaki Airport (HNA) is conveniently located only 3.2km from the city, making it an ideal choice for quick access. Nearby hotels include the 4-star Hanamaki Onsen Kashoen and the 3.5-star YamaYuri No Yado, both situated just 6.4km away. Alternatively, Akita Airport (AXT) is located 53.2km away, with popular hotels like the 3.5-star ANA Crowne Plaza Akita and Richmond Hotel Akita Ekimae, both 14.5km from the airport. What should I do while I'm visiting Hanamaki?
Cultural venues include Kenji Miyazawa Memorial Museum, Takamura Kotaro Museum, and Yorozu Tetsugoro Memorial Museum of Art. Landmarks like Hanamaki Castle, Kiyomizu-dera Temple, and Narushima Bishamondo Shrine might be worth a visit. Natural beauty is on display at Hanamaki Onsen Rose Garden, English Beach, and Hanamaki Koiki Park. Check out what more to see and do in Expedia's Hanamaki guide.
How should I get around Hanamaki?
To venture out into the surrounding area, hop on a train at Shin-Hanamaki Station. If you want to venture out around the area, you may want a rental car in Hanamaki for your journey.
What's the weather like in Hanamaki?
The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 67°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 29°F. The rainiest months in Hanamaki are July, August, September, and October, with each month seeing an average of 7 inches of rainfall.
